Finally got everything installed and dialed in.
20x10.5 +45 Square Velgen VMB5 w/ 16mm spacer up front (yes you read that correctly)
ARP Front Wheel Studs
295/30/20 Bridgestone Potenza
Fortune Auto Coilovers (review coming soon, I’m impressed compared to BC Racing and ST XTAs)
